Thanks Typically, rollaway beds are only allowed in suites since most other cabins do not have the floor space for a rollaway. We have sailed in 1688 on Mariner, which is the mirror image of 1388. There is enough space for a rollaway but would be very tight with the sofabed open too. Doesn't hurt to ask, but my guess is they say no.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
